Output d20966edab05f5901f998399762bc46dd06f818a2d108008361b5fb78153e855:110

value
72775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9688acb8b740f861a82ff9949f3586222a3768a2 OP_EQUAL
address
3FQy1eDeDoLDcj7QMJRFJaoKmKu9cGeYLT
transaction
d20966edab05f5901f998399762bc46dd06f818a2d108008361b5fb78153e855